site stats

Sql server show locks

WebDec 31, 2014 · 51CTO博客已为您找到关于mysqldump: Couldn't execute 'SET OPTION SQL_QUOTE_SHOW_CREATE=1': You have a的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及mysqldump: Couldn't execute 'SET OPTION SQL_QUOTE_SHOW_CREATE=1': You have a问答内容。更多mysqldump: Couldn't execute … WebJun 16, 2024 · SQL Server provides the Dynamics Management View (DMV) sys.dm_tran_locks that returns information about lock manager resources that are currently in use, which means that it will display all “live” locks acquired by transactions. More details about this DMV can be found in the sys.dm_tran_locks (Transact-SQL) article.

All about locking in SQL Server - SQL Shack

WebFeb 28, 2024 · You can control the locking of read operations by using the following tools: SET TRANSACTION ISOLATION LEVEL to specify the level of locking for a session. For more information, see SET TRANSACTION ISOLATION LEVEL (Transact-SQL). Locking table hints to specify the level of locking for an individual reference of a table in a FROM clause. WebMay 19, 2024 · Fortunately, the SQL Server database engine comes with a deadlock monitor thread that will periodically check for deadlock situations, choose one of the processes implied as a victim for termination. While … flight from bangkok to laos https://vr-fotografia.com

Troubleshooting Blocking in SQL Server using SQL Monitor

WebJul 27, 2012 · There are many different ways in SQL Server to identify a blocks and blocking process that are listed as follow: Activity Monitor SQLServer:Locks Performance Object … WebIt would be better to look at your indexes, optimize the resource usage of your query and to automatically avoid this situation from happening. Kill Blocking Locks and Deadlocks The following script can be automated via SQLServer Agent Jobs or executed manually to help you kill connections: T-SQL Transact-SQL 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 chemistry bursaries 2023

Lock and Unlock Record in SQL Server Database - iSunshare blog

Category:locking - Limits of applock in MS SQL Server - Database …

Tags:Sql server show locks

Sql server show locks

What are SQL Server deadlocks and how to monitor …

WebMay 1, 2015 · You can view the locks for a session using sp_lock or sys.dm_tran_locks. In both ways you can filter by the session. You can also use Extended Events to do that. … WebNov 21, 2000 · Microsoft recommends to use sp_lock system stored procedure to report locks information. This very useful procedure returns the information about SQL Server process ID, which lock the data, about locked database ID, about locked object ID, about locked index ID and about type of locking (type, resource, mode and status columns).

Sql server show locks

Did you know?

WebJul 5, 2024 · What is Lock in SQL Server? As we all know, multiple users need to access databases concurrently. So locks come into the picture to prevent data from being … Web8 rows · Feb 28, 2024 · The SQLServer:Locks object in Microsoft SQL Server provides information about SQL Server ...

WebOct 1, 2010 · Here is what I have tried so far but it doesnt show me who has the lock. SELECT * FROM sys.dm_tran_locks . We have trouble from time to time with a job or user who has a lock that is blocking and we need to be able to see who or what it is. I dont really know how to do this and sp_lock and sp_who dont show who or the last tsql command. WebJul 15, 2011 · The second option in SQL Server Management Studio to monitor blocking is with the standard reports, which can be accessed by navigating to the instance name, …

WebJan 30, 2024 · To determine which process is the blocking process log into SQL Server Management Studio and run the attached SQL script ( Blocking.sql ). Alternatively, execute the query (s) below : Script to Find All the Blocked Processes: SELECT spid, status, loginame=SUBSTRING (loginame,1,12), hostname=SUBSTRING (hostname,1, 12), WebTo find blocks using this method, open SQL Server Management Studio and connect to the SQL Server instance you wish to monitor. After you have connected, right click on the …

WebJun 23, 2024 · Locking is unavoidable in SQL Server. It happens when a session maintains a lock on a resource while other sessions try to simultaneously acquire conflicting locks on the resource. ... The “Details” link for the blocking sessions will show the top SQL statements executed while other sessions were being blocked. If excessive wait times have ...

WebOct 7, 2014 · If you want a visual aid in detecting your locks there is an open source tool available called SQL lock finder. You can find the source on: … chemistry bursary 2023WebMar 3, 2024 · To do this, use Query Editor in SQL Server Management Studio. To find the objects that have the most locks In Query Editor, issue the following statements. SQL Copy -- Find objects in a particular database that have the most -- lock acquired. This sample uses AdventureWorksDW2012. -- Create the session and add an event and target. chemistry by asher angelWebshow engine innodb status; as mentioned in Marko's link. This will give you the locking query, how many rows/tables are locked by it etc. Look under TRANSACTIONS. The problem with using SHOW PROCESSLIST is that you won't … flight from bangkok to hongWebAug 28, 2024 · When sp_blitzindex reports Lock Escalation Attempts, that's useful information. If we decide, having assessed the impact and resource needs, to DISABLE Lock Escalation, in place of the reports of attempts/actual escalations, perhaps show "(Lock Escalation DISABLE)" flight from bangkok to hanoi vietnamWebSep 6, 2024 · The SQL Server lock manager keeps track of the number of locks held by the current transaction. When a lock is acquired, the count is incremented. When a lock is released, the counter is decremented. Converting an existing lock, for example from U to X has no net effect on the counter. chemistry buret clampWebDec 29, 2024 · In SQL Server Management Studio (SSMS) Object Explorer, right-click the top-level server object, expand Reports, expand Standard Reports, and then select Activity - All Blocking Transactions. This report shows current transactions at … chemistry burnerWebLocks in SQL Server. The lock is a mechanism associated with a table for restricting unauthorized access to the data. It is mainly used to solve the concurrency problem in transactions. We can apply a lock on row level, database level, table level, and page level. This article will discuss the lock mechanism and how to monitor them in SQL ... flight from bangkok to penang malaysia